The Hallé
Sir Mark Elder Conductor

Debussy Nocturnes (Nuages and Fetes)
Wagner  Meistersinger Suite
Strauss Ein Heldenleben

Fortunately, Sir Mark Elder's 2024 farewell concert was a brief goodbye, not a complete departure. He returns to Nottingham as Conductor Emeritus of the Halle Orchestra to lead this symphonic programme beginning with two of Debussy's characteristically Impressionistic Nocturnes. With nuanced nods to the French landscape, “Nuages” represents the melancholy movement of softy-tinted clouds, polarised by “Fêtes”, a rhythmically-drive depiction of a buzzing, vivid carnival.

Wagner's Meistersinger Suite condenses the four and a half hours of Opera into twenty minutes, taking in key moments from Act Three, including the apprentices’ Dance, as well as the grand Prelude to Act One – music that’s as colourful as the opera’s often spectacular stagings. Increasing the drama is Strauss’s Ein Heldenleben (A Hero's Life), an electrifying self-portrait which masters the dynamic capacity of the immense late 19th century orchestra. With a deliberate nod to Beethoven's triumphant key of E flat, glorious horn fanfares and virtuosic violin melodies run throughout Strauss’s six continuous sections that depict the gallant hero's battles, relationships, and tranquil retirement.
